Portimao FP1: Bottas sets the early pace

It might be a new track, but it was a very familiar story with Valtteri Bottas leading a Mercedes 1-2 in first practice for the Portuguese Grand Prix on Friday. Topping the timesheets with a 1:18.140, Bottas was 0.339 seconds ahead of teammate Lewis Hamilton in an intriguing session to mark Formula 1's return to Portimao.   Report in progress…
